I have a pair of UE11Pros (LOVE THEM, by the way -- best 'phones I've ever listened to), and yes, they do have removable / replaceable cables. In fact, the standard cable that comes with these IEMs is perfectly long enough to comfortably go from your head (ears) to your waist (belt pack receiver). With the cable coming from around your back, it's a bit short to let you hold your music player out in front of you...make sure to get the longer cable if you want to put your music player a bit further from your body (like, say, in the seat back pocket).
